The Nargacuga is a beast of the shadows, and becomes enraged by bright light. At the risk of missing the mark and simply riling it up further, its excellent hearing can be exploited by throwing a Sonic Bomb as it pauses to focus. It can destory Pitfall Traps, so be discreet when placing them.

The Nargacuga is a Flying Wyvern that is mostly known for hiding amongst the shadows and becoming enraged by bright light. Thankfully, Nargacuga's sensitive hearing can be exploited by throwing Sonic Bombs. Pitfall traps have also proven helpful, especially when attempting the catch the monster during its enraged phases. When enraged, you'll want to ensure that you're attacking Nargacuga's head, snout, and tail, as these are its weakest and most vulnerable areas. When it comes to selecting weapons , you're best option will be to attack with Thunder based weapons, as this element will deal the most significant amount of damage. Alternatively, if Thunder based weapons are not available, your second best option will be to focus on Fire based weapons.

Flying wyverns that have evolved to live in thickly wooded areas. Covered in jet black fur, these cunning predators stalk their prey from the shadows and attack with ferocious speed. Their massive tails are as dexterous as they are deadly, and powerful enough to slay smaller monsters with one strike.
